A question that many people ask at this time of the year is: "Why is our street pavement being resealed when it still looks in reasonable condition?"

Residents wonder why Auckland Transport spends money on resealing when there could still be a few years of life left in the pavement. I have investigated residents’ concerns and only once have I found that there isn't a justifiable reason for the reseal.

On one occasion the contractors got the wrong street and the pavement still had a number of years left before the next reseal.

A good fresh seal puts a waterproof membrane over the surface and ensures that water does not leak into the road's foundations. It is essential that this resealing is done on a programmed basis to maintain our roads to a high standard of serviceability.
